Property Overview: 114 Cobourg Avenue, Winnipeg

Key Characteristics & Appeal

This is a substantial, century-old home (built 1911) in the Glenelm neighbourhood, offering generous interior space and a solid footprint. Its primary appeal lies in its above-average living area of 1,928 sq ft, which ranks in the top 3% of homes on its street and the top 5% within Glenelm. This makes it a notably spacious option for the area. The property sits on a lot that is larger than most on Cobourg Avenue, providing valuable outdoor space.

The home presents as a classic "blank canvas" property. Its basement exists but is not renovated, there is no garage or pool, and its assessed value is modest relative to the city-wide average. This combination suggests a property with good underlying structure and space, but one that requires vision and investment for modernization. It would suit a practical buyer looking for character and room to grow in a mature neighbourhood, who is prepared for the updates and maintenance that come with a 115-year-old home. A thoughtful perspective is that its lower assessment, compared to its generous living area, could represent a strategic entry point into a well-located neighbourhood for a hands-on owner.


Frequently Asked Questions

1. Why is the assessed value so much lower than the city-wide average?
Property assessments are based on a mass appraisal system considering many factors, including home condition, specific location, and recent area sales. The modest assessment here likely reflects the home’s age and the fact it has not been recently renovated, not necessarily its ultimate market value.

2. What does "basement yes, not renovated" typically mean?
This indicates the home has a foundational basement, but it remains in a basic, unfinished state. It likely has utility functions but would require significant work to become a finished living space, representing both a project and an opportunity for added square footage.

3. The home last sold in 2019 for a relatively low price. What does that indicate?
The sold price from several years ago is a historical data point and may reflect the property’s condition or the market at that specific time. It does not directly dictate current value, which is influenced by today’s market conditions, recent comparable sales, and any changes made to the property since.

4. With no garage, what are parking options?
Buyers should anticipate relying on on-street parking. It’s advisable to check local bylaws for any permit requirements or restrictions, which is common in many established neighbourhoods.

5. How significant is the "top 3%" living area ranking for the street?
This statistic highlights a key advantage: this home offers significantly more interior space than most of its immediate neighbours. For buyers prioritizing roominess over turn-key condition on this specific street, it stands out as a rare find.
